Porsche Carrera GT

Porsche Carrera GT

Developed in 1999, Porsche Carrera GT, manufactured by Porsche of Germany, is priced at $440,000 dollars. It is well worth its price if we count the 5.7 litre V10 engine producing 612 DIN (605 SAE) horsepower (450 kW) and the acceleration from 0 to 100 km/h (62.5 mph) in 3.9 seconds, touching a maximum speed of 330 km/h (205 mph).

The design is stunning too, Carrera GT has a 5 colors paint schemes that includes: black, guards red, fayence yellow, basalt black, GT silver and seal grey.

The innovating thing about this car is the way that its engine is placed: with the use of a clutch made of a high-tech ceramic material, it`s allowing the engine to sit lower in the chassis than in any other super car. This feature is not only making the Carrera GT a road car with the looks of a race one, but also improves its aerodynamics and lowers its center of gravity.

Porche Carrera GT does have traction control even if, like some of its competitions, doesn`t use electronic driving aids such as dynamic stability control.

Mercedes-Benz SLR McLaren Roadster

Mercedes-Benz SLR McLaren Roadster 

The Mercedes-Benz SLR McLaren Roadster is a super sports car with high performance and stylish looks. The cost for owning this car is approximately $495,000.

The body of the Mercedes-Benz SLR McLaren Roadster is made of carbon fiber, due to this, the car is of less weight and provides more security for the passengers.

The Mercedes-Benz SLR McLaren Roadster features a Supercharged V8 engine with a capacity of 5439 cc. The engine delivers an output power of 617 bhp at 6500 rpm and 575 lb-ft torque at 3250 rpm. The car reaches the speed of 60 mph in 3.8 seconds and the top speed is about 206 mph. The car features 5-speed Automatic transmission and the gear shifts can be performed easily and smoothly even at higher loads.

The car has an open top which is operated by the touch of a button. The safety features in the car includes the air brakes, tire pressure monitoring system and air bags.

The exteriors feature the stylish open top and the interiors feature the air conditioning system, sporty steering wheel and the BOSE sound system.

SSC Ultimate Aero

SSC Ultimate Aero

The SSC Ultimate Aero is a powerful engine sports car manufactured by Shelby SuperCars. The precious SSC Ultimate Aero TT is the world’s fastest production car, which travels at a top speed of 257 mph.

The new version known as 2009 SSC Ultimate Aero has been modified where some changes have been added to the exteriors, interiors, and the increase of horsepower about 15%. The most important change is the single piece aluminum block engine that improves the oiling capabilities and structure of the engine, so that the SSC Ultimate Aero produces an output of about 1287 horsepower.

At the cost of $654,000 and with a newly designed engine, the Ultimate Aero can reach a maximum speed of 270 mph, which is a world record speed. It can reach from 0 to 60 mph in 2.7 secs. The front face of the car has been redesigned with improved aerodynamics and carbon fiber which draws 20% additional air to the radiators for better cooling.

The AeroBrakeTM system has been introduced in this car which is a rear spoiler system that can be controlled by a switch. The spoiler speed can be set depending on the pressure applied on the brake pedal.


The interiors are mostly designed of carbon fibers that bound the doors, steering column, speedometer and tachometer.

McLaren F1

McLaren F1

McLaren F1 is the most powerful supercar produced by McLaren between the years 1994-1998, from the 100 cars: 65 are street versions, 5 are LMs (which was build to honor victory at Le Mans in 1995) and 3 are Gts (the road versions of the 1997 F1 GTR racing car) and 28 F1 GTR made for the roads.
 
The Chief Engineer Gordon Murroy`s concept refers to the use of expensive materials like: carbon, titanium, gold and for the first time, the use of carbon fiber monocoque chassis.

Power? Here is a good question, the car has the power output at 627 horsepower or has an imperial HP. The super car is powered by an 6 L V12 engine built by BMW, 627 HP at 7400 rmp, same as road car version.

The car has a top speed of 386 km/h or 240 mph (very good speed for 1994) and can reach a speed of 100 km/h in 3.2 seconds, 200 km/h in 6.7 seconds and 300 km/h in 30 seconds. The McLaren F1 was the fastest car in the world until Bugatti Veyron was introduced.

When it was first introduced, it was priced at $970,000. This type of car is not produced anymore and it is very rare to find one of these on the market.

Lamborghini Reventon


Lamborghini Reventon
Lamborghini presents the ultimate driving machine among open-top two-seaters – the Reventón Roadster is a sports car of breathtaking fascination, menacing power and uncompromising performance. The 6.5 liter twelve-cylinder generates 493 kW (670 PS), catapulting the Roadster from 0 to 100 Km/h (0 to 62 mph) in 3.4 seconds and onwards to a top speed of 330 KM/h (205 mph). The open-top Reventón is not only one of the fastest, but also one of the most exclusive cars in the world – Lamborghini has limited the series.

The Lamborghini Reventón is not destined to remain a one-off. Less than 20 Lamborghini friends and collectors will be able to own this extraordinary car and, naturally, enjoy the incomparable pleasure of driving it.

Each Reventón Roadster will be sold for 1.1 Million Euro (without taxes). Deliveries will begin October 2009.

"The Reventón is the most extreme car in the history of the brand," comments Stephan Winkelmann, President and CEO of Automobili Lamborghini S.p.A. "The new Roadster adds an extra emotional component to our combined technological expertise – it unites superior performance with the sensual fascination of open-top driving." The Reventón Coupé was presented at the 2007 IAA in Frankfurt and was sold out immediately.

Open-top sports cars are a tradition at Lamborghini that stretches back over 40 years. In 1968, the company from Sant'Agata Bolognese built a Miura without a fixed roof as a one-off. The Diablo Roadster appeared in 1995 with its targa roof anchored to the engine cover.

Sculpture with extreme dynamics

All Lamborghinis are created with an avantgarde approach to design; a fast-moving technical sculpture. The Reventón Roadster is derived from the same creative thinking as the Coupé. Its designers found their inspiration in aviation – the aggressive wedge shape evokes images of fighter jets.
The powerful arrowhead form at the front, the mighty air intakes pulled way forward, the broad side skirts, the upwards opening scissor doors and the rear end with its menacing edges – the Roadster is clad in a design of maximum functionality and spectacular clarity. Details set stylish accents, such as headlamps featuring bi-xenon units with LEDs forming the daytime running lights and indicators. The rear lamps are also equipped with LEDs.

Like the Coupé, the Reventón Roadster measures 4700 mm (185 in.) long. It has a wheelbase of 2665 mm (105 in.) and is 2058 mm (81 in.) wide and 1132 mm (45 in.) high. The driver and passenger seating positions are low and sporty, separated by a substantial central tunnel.

Behind the two seats are two hidden pop-up bars that deploy upwards in just a few hundredths of a second in the event of an imminent rollover. A fixed, horizontal wing-shaped member behind the seats bears the third brake light. The design of the Roadster's long back is also quite distinct from that of the Coupé. The engine bonnet is virtually horizontal and a total of four windows made from glass provide a view of the mighty V12 in all its technical elegance.

Stiff bodyshell base

The base bodyshell of the Reventón is already so stiff that the Roadster requires only minimal reinforcement. It has a dry weight of only 1690 Kg (3,725 lbs.), just 25 Kg, (55 lbs.) more than the Coupé.

Like the Coupé, the cell of the Roadster is made from high-strength steel profile and carbon components joined with specialist adhesive and rivets. The bodyshell is made almost entirely from carbon fiber elements, with sheet steel used only for the outer door skins.

Aircraft-style displays

The interior of the Reventón Roadster conveys the same powerful design as the exterior. The cockpit is structured with technical clarity, the interfaces arranged for functionality. Like a modern aircraft, the open two-seater no longer has classic analogue instrumentation – instead, information is delivered via two transreflective and one transmissive liquid-crystal displays.

The driver can switch between two modes at the touch of a button – one digital view with illuminated bars and one level with classic round dials, albeit with changing color graphics. Centrally located at the top of the display is the G-force meter. It represents the intensity of the forces acting on the Reventón Roadster under acceleration, braking and heavy cornering; the same format used in Formula 1.

The instruments are mounted in a casing machined from solid aluminum which is housed in a carbon fiber dashboard. The interior displays uncompromisingly clean craftsmanship and features a host of carbon fiber applications – e.g. on the center tunnel – aluminum, Alcantara and leather. The central panels and the seat cushions are perforated, with precision stitching gracing their outer edges.

An icon of engine design

The twelve-cylinder engine that powers the Reventón Roadster is a Lamborghini icon – and the technical feature that defines the character of the car. It is one of the world's most powerful naturally-aspirated engines. With a compression ratio of 11 : 1 and a displacement of 6496 cc (396.41 in3,) it generates 670 PS (493 kW) at 8,000 rpm. Its maximum torque of 660 Nm (487 lb-ft) kicks in at 6,000 rpm.

The V12 engine is a masterpiece of Italian engineering. Two chains drive its four camshafts that, in turn, operate the 48 valves. Together with the three-phase adjustable intake manifold, the variable valve timing delivers a meaty torque build-up. Dry sump lubrication ensures that the hi-tech power unit has a constant supply of oil, even under heavy lateral acceleration. The absence of the oil sump means a low mounting position – benefitting the car's outstanding handling characteristics.

The V12 catapults the Reventón Roadster from 0 to 100 Km/h (0 to 62 mph) in 3.4 seconds and onwards to a top speed of 330 Km/h (205 mph). All-wheel drive for maximum traction

In classic Lamborghini style, the aluminum engine is mounted longitudinally in front of the rear axle, with the transmission ahead of it beneath the center tunnel. This layout results in 58 percent of the overall weight being borne by the rear wheels – ideal for a powerful sports car.

This layout accommodates the Viscous Traction permanent all-wheel drive. Under normal conditions, it sends the vast majority of the driving force to the rear wheels. Should they begin to spin, the central viscous coupling sends up to 35 percent of the power via an additional shaft to the front axle. Limited-slip differentials are located there and at the rear axle with 25 and 45 percent lock respectively.

Lamborghini introduced the all-wheel drive principle with the Diablo. The reason back then was just as clear as it is today - four driven wheels grip far better than two, and the more powerful the engine, the greater the impact of this fundamental law of physics.

Also standard on the Reventón Roadster is the e.gear automated six-speed sequential manual transmission. The driver controls the gear shift, which is activated hydraulically via two steering wheel paddles. In addition to the "Normal" mode, the system offers a "Corsa" and a "low adherence" mode. The driver just has to keep his foot to the floor - the rest is handled by e.gear.

Running gear layout from motorsport

The Reventón Roadster keeps the extreme power of its engine in check with a running gear layout derived directly from motorsport. Each wheel boasts double wishbone suspension, with one spring strut on each side of the front axle and two each at the rear. The front end of the car can be raised by 40 mm (about 1.6 in.) to protect the underside of the vehicle over potholes or on steep entrances into underground garages.

The open two-seater runs on 18-inch wheels. The front tires measure 245/35, while the rears are 335/30. Dedicated air channels in the bodyshell cool the four wheel brakes. Carbon-fiber ceramic discs are standard – they have an extremely lightweight construction, operate with virtually no fade, are corrosion-free and achieve the highest service life. Each disc has a diameter of 380 mm (~15 in.) and is gripped by six-piston calipers.

High-performance aerodynamics

A further distinctive characteristic of the Reventón Roadster is its calm directional stability even at extremely high speeds – a feature that also turns fast highway stretches into sheer joy. Alongside the bodyshell design and the smooth underbody, which culminates in a powerfully formed diffuser, the rear spoiler carries responsibility for downforce. It deploys from the rear edge at about 130 Km/h (80 mph) and adopts an even steeper angle as of about 220 Km/h (136 mph). The entire aerodynamic concept – around and through the car – is radically laid out for performance.

Bugatti Veyron


Bugatti Veyron

Not just a super car that carries on the name of racing driver Pierre Veyron, who, while racing for the original Bugatti car manufacturer, won the 24 hours of Le Mans in 1939, Bugatti Veyron 16.4 is the second fastest car in the world and the most powerful, it can easily pass as a super hero`s car like Batman. It has the fastest acceleration speed, reaching 60 mph in 2.6 seconds.

Endowed with W16 engine-16 cylinders in 4 banks of 4 cylinders fed by four turbochargers, a dual-clutch DSG computer-controlled manual transmission, the Veyron has a length is 4462 mm (175.8 in) a wide of 1998 mm (78.7 in) and hight of 1206 mm (47.5 in). Counting a sum of 10 radiators, for the engine cooling system, for transmission oil, a heat exchanger for the air to liquid intercoolers, for engine oil etc., the car has a power to weight ratio of 529 bhp/tonne.

If we talk about performance we are dazzled by this supercars power to reach 200 and 300 km/h (124 and 186 mph) in 7.3 and respectively 16.7 seconds, wining for herself the name of the quickest-accelerating production car in history. If we count the fact that the top speed of Bugatti Veyron is 253.2 miles per hour (407.5 km/h), a speed limited electronically to prevent tire damage (it can run even faster) we can understand why this spectacular car must consume 40.4 L/100 km (4.82 mpg) when it`s running at top speed and in city driving 24.1 L/100 km.

A model drove by superstars like Tom Cruise, couldn`t name itself cheap, rising the Bugatti Veyron at least of $1,700,000, a price that measures it`s quality. Many new designs has been released since 2006, the color might have changed, but the speed and power remain the same.

2010 Jaguar XJ


2010 Jaguar XJ

There are classics in car design, such as Ford's Mustang and Porsche's 911, whose shapes have persisted with subtle variations for forty years.Jaguar's XJ sedan is almost equally long-lived, but sales have dropped as it passed through many iterations that were all much too closely based--even the last all-aluminum model--on Sir William Lyon's original design. Now, finally, the XJ has a completely new shape, impressively handsome and vastly better, in terms of space and comfort, than any of its forebears.

The initial presentation to the American press at Hedsor House, an archetypical English stately home, was the best I've experienced in half a century of seeing new cars before their public showing: we were marshaled onto a second floor balcony overlooking the home's beautiful park and its long driveway. Two of the new cars--one of each wheelbase--approached and moved smoothly around the area so we could see them from every direction while Jaguar design leader Ian Callum talked about their design. Given that it is impossible to properly judge a new design until you have seen it in motion, this was a brilliant way to present a vitally important product.

The XJ has some elements reminiscent of the midrange XF, in particular the nearly rectangular trapezoidal grille, but in all respects the XJ is more refined, elegant, and impressive. Its six-window side profile is elongated and beautifully delineated by a bright metal surround culminating in a thicker section at the pointed aft end.

The C-pillars are a glossy black on every car. Questioned about making it body color, Callum insists that the difference is important, even on cars painted black, where only surface reflectivity, not color, changes. There is no question that the upper looks wider with darkened glass and the blacked-out pillars. Dramatic elongated taillights owe nothing to the past.

The body sides are quite plain, with only a small chrome vent on the front fender behind the wheel opening and a slight indentation through the front doors that disappears a third of the way back on the rear door panels. There are sharp peaks to the front and rear fenders, well outboard, to emphasize the body's width.

The front profile rounds down following the wheel opening, allowing the hood and grille to thrust forward, with the headlamps joining the disparate profiles. A subtle bulge above the center of the headlamp cover recalls, almost subliminally, surfaces behind the headlamps of the original XJ. The interior is pure classic Jaguar, raised to the nth power. The sound system is so good that by contrast it puts the Lexus "concert hall" into the provincial high-school gymnasium category.

Life is going to be difficult for all luxury car makers now (much like the 1930s, when many makes disappeared), but we think Jaguar has an excellent chance, if only based on the fact that everyone who saw the XJ was eager to drive it as soon as possible.
